July 14, 2008 - Being the Change You Want to See: A Guide for Pre-Med Students
“Being the Change You Want to See: A Guide for Pre-Med Students” was hosted by seven NC Fellows on July 12, 2008 for students enrolled in the Summer Medical Dental Enrichment program (SMDEP) at Duke School of Medicine. SMDEP has 80 participants from 27 states and 55 schools who self identify as underserved or under-represented minorities interested in applying for medical school. The symposium offered these students small group workshops about the primary and secondary application processes, MCAT preparation, dual degree programs, post graduate planning and clinical skills training. The primary objective is to increase the number of caring, culturally competent and capable physicians who are willing to dedicate their careers to addressing health disparities. The keynote speaker Dr. Julius Wilder, MD, PhD introduced this theme, and delivered a speech about the importance of a life of service. Students rotated through the workshops, learned about the application process, networked with medical students and staff, and received a booklet summarizing the discussed materials. The symposium team included Duke School of Medicine Fellows Emias Abebe, Moira Breslin, Michael Raisch, Genevieve Ricart, Loren Robinson, Jennifer Waddy and UNC School of Medicine Fellow Chris Dibble.
